Exploring the Truth About Garcinia Cambogia

Garcinia cambogia has gained significant traction in recent years as a potential weight loss supplement. Proponents maintain that this extract from the rind of the Garcinia gummi-garum fruit can control appetite, enhance metabolism, and stop fat production. However, the scientific evidence to support these assertions is mixed.

Some studies have shown that garcinia cambogia may slightly reduce body weight and fat mass, but the outcomes are often small. Moreover, many studies are of low quality, making it difficult to draw firm conclusions about its effectiveness.

The primary active compound in garcinia cambogia is hydroxycitric acid (HCA), which is believed to work by suppressing an enzyme called citrate lyase, involved in fat production. However, more studies are needed to fully understand the actions underlying garcinia cambogia's potential effects on weight loss.
